Brigham Buhler: UnitedHealthcare CEO Assassination, & the Mass Monetization of Chronic Illness

Like, it's terrifying. So I love using the example of metformin because it's a very simplistic number that I can show you. If you come into a pharmacy and you tell me you have UnitedHealthcare, I have a gag clause as a pharmacy owner. It is illegal for me to tell you that I could sell you your Metformin for cheaper than what the insurance is charging you. But you paid for that insurance coverage.

Why can't I disclose to you that I can give you the product for cash cheaper than your copay? So you come in, I swipe your card. Met Forman cost me, I'm going to use ballpark numbers, roughly $2 for a month's supply. I would have sold you the Met Forman for $4. I'm not allowed to tell you that. I swipe your card. It tells me to charge you $10. That's your copay. So I charge you a $10 copay.
